Throw out everything you think a classical concert should be—then step into something electric with Groupmuse Nights Out, offering discounted tickets to Delirium Musicum at 2245 in Los Angeles on Saturday, March 28 at 8:00 PM. Led by violinist and visionary Etienne Gara, this fearless ensemble of 16 musicians transforms the concert experience into something visceral, spontaneous, and utterly alive. Praised as “ferocious and rhythmically mesmerizing,” Delirium Musicum doesn’t just perform music—they ignite it, pulling audiences into a shared, high-voltage journey where precision meets wild abandon.
The program pairs the driving brilliance of J.S. Bach’s Brandenburg Concerto No. 3 with a bold, reimagined take on Mussorgsky’s Pictures at an Exhibition (in an arrangement by Jacques Cohen). Expect dazzling virtuosity, unexpected textures, and a sound that pulses with urgency and imagination. What's the music?
BACH | "Brandenburg" Concerto no. 3 in G major, BWV 1048
MUSSORGSKY | Pictures at an Exhibition (Arrangement by Jacques Cohen)
